President Museveni Meets NRM Caucus

President Yoweri Kaguta Museveni this afternoon met with the NRM Parliamentary Caucus at State House Entebbe, where he provided strategic guidance on the Government’s priorities for the Financial Year 2026/2027. The discussions focused on aligning national planning with key development goals, as well as underscoring the importance of the Protection of Sovereignty Bill, 2025 in safeguarding Uganda’s independence and interests.

During the meeting, President Museveni and the legislators reached a shared position on prioritizing critical sectors that drive Uganda’s socio-economic transformation. These include strengthening peace and security, expanding and maintaining road infrastructure, enhancing electricity access, and advancing the development of the national railway network. Emphasis was also placed on promoting scientific innovation as a cornerstone for long-term growth, alongside preparations to successfully host AFCON 2027.

In addition, the President highlighted the importance of targeted interventions such as restocking programs in the sub-regions of Teso, Lango, and Acholi to boost household incomes and agricultural productivity. The meeting also resolved to support salary enhancement for teachers, TVET staff, and security personnel as part of efforts to improve service delivery and strengthen human capital development.

These strategic priorities reflect the Government’s continued commitment to inclusive development, national stability, and the protection of Uganda’s sovereignty.
